It is an alternating, interactive, textbased RPG. In other words at this point as you have created your Character you can post what he is doing in a short story that leaves the action open for another writer to come in and respond and vice verso. many people can write together and it is interesting to see how each responds to the other just like real life conversation. After a while the thread becomes a story that has alternated between the many characters involved. Look at some of the other threads. I would suggest my first one called "the Ratcatcher and the Bear" You will see how it works and most likely have fun reading the story!
It totaly relies on creativity and imagination while honing your writing skills!
